Rising Adoption of Compressed Natural Gas Vehicles in Brazil

Comments · 8 Views

CNG vehicles in Brazil are gaining popularity due to cost savings, cleaner emissions, and growing infrastructure supporting natural gas mobility.

 

 

The Compressed Natural Gas Vehicles Brazil segment is experiencing increasing adoption as the country moves toward cleaner and more efficient transportation options. The growing emphasis on reducing emissions and fuel costs is driving this trend. The Compressed Natural Gas Vehicles Brazil market is becoming an integral part of Brazil’s automotive landscape.

One of the key advantages of CNG vehicles is their environmental performance. They produce lower levels of harmful emissions compared to traditional fuel vehicles, contributing to improved air quality. This makes them particularly suitable for use in densely populated urban areas.

Cost efficiency is another major factor driving adoption. CNG is generally more affordable than gasoline and diesel, making it an attractive option for consumers and businesses alike. This economic benefit is encouraging more people to switch to CNG-powered vehicles.

Infrastructure development is supporting this growth. The increasing number of CNG refueling stations is making it easier for users to access fuel, reducing concerns about convenience. This expansion is playing a crucial role in encouraging adoption.

Technological advancements are also enhancing the appeal of CNG vehicles. Improvements in engine design and fuel storage systems are making these vehicles more efficient and reliable. These innovations are helping to overcome earlier limitations and increase consumer confidence.

In conclusion, the compressed natural gas vehicles market in Brazil is poised for continued growth. With strong demand, supportive infrastructure, and ongoing innovation, the sector offers promising opportunities for the future.
